[QUOTE="MontanaRifleman, post: 218358, member: 11717"] ole mike, thanks for the info. I called Dakota Firearms last week and Hornaday now makes their 330 and 375 brass and Norma makes their their 7mm and 300 brass. Nesika Chad, I did talk to Ward last week and got some good infoo from him. The 300, 330 and 375 all have basically the same case capasity and the 7mm is a little shorter (2.50 vs 2.55) with about 7 water grains in capasity differnce. locotrician, glad to see your post. I am alos leaning toward a 27" barrel. What velociteis are you getting from your 300? I am hoping to push a 200 gr bullet to 3100 fps or beter. [/QUOTE]
